Core Viewpoint - The article highlights the advancements in green building technologies implemented by China State Construction Engineering Corporation (CSCEC), showcasing their efforts in energy efficiency and carbon reduction through innovative solutions in their headquarters and the surrounding industrial park [2][4]. Group 1: Building Innovations - The headquarters building in Wuhan features 14,000 square meters of monocrystalline silicon photovoltaic panels, contributing to energy generation [2]. - The installation of energy recovery devices in elevators has improved operational smoothness and allowed for energy regeneration, enhancing overall energy efficiency [2]. - The building's glass curtain wall has been treated with a special heat-insulating film, achieving a heat insulation rate of 72%, which results in an annual energy saving of 252,000 kWh and a reduction of approximately 126 tons of CO2 emissions [2]. Group 2: Smart Operations - The development of a "zero-carbon smart operation platform" integrates over 3,000 device parameters, utilizing IoT and AI technologies to optimize indoor air quality and energy use, leading to an annual carbon reduction of about 87.6 tons [3]. - The building's comfort has been enhanced through modifications such as the installation of air curtains and adjustments to heating systems, resulting in a temperature increase of approximately 9 degrees Celsius in the lobby during winter while minimizing energy loss [3]. Group 3: Energy Management - A newly constructed underground comprehensive energy station utilizes wastewater heat pump technology, converting effluent from a nearby treatment plant into a secondary energy source, which is expected to reduce carbon emissions by 2,300 tons annually [4]. - The industrial park features a photovoltaic system with a capacity of 2.1 MW, generating 2,156,000 kWh of electricity per year, equivalent to a reduction of 1,078.2 tons of CO2 emissions [4]. - The lighting system operates on a demand basis, contributing to an annual carbon reduction of 67.5 tons, while a new energy storage system lowers energy costs by 23% [4]. Group 4: Overall Impact - The overall carbon reduction achieved by the industrial park is 30%, while the headquarters building has achieved a 45% reduction in carbon emissions through these various upgrades and innovations [4].

Core Viewpoint - The automotive film market in China is experiencing significant growth driven by the booming automotive market, with increasing demand in both new and aftermarket segments. By 2024, the demand for automotive films is projected to reach 25,061.27 million square meters, with a market size of 49.992 billion yuan [1][9]. Market Overview - Automotive films are specialized materials applied to vehicle windows and surfaces, serving functions such as heat insulation, sun protection, explosion resistance, and privacy protection. They can also reduce UV damage to interior items and occupants, lower cabin temperatures, and decrease fuel consumption by reducing air conditioning use. The films are categorized into three main types: protective films, color-changing films, and heat-insulating films [2][4]. Market Policies - The Chinese government has implemented various policies to support the development of the automotive film industry, including guidelines for digital transformation, green manufacturing, and standardization. These policies aim to enhance compliance, upgrade production standards, and promote high-quality development in the industry [4][5]. Supply Chain Structure - The automotive film industry supply chain consists of upstream suppliers of raw materials (such as PET films and adhesives), midstream manufacturers involved in R&D and production, and downstream markets that include both OEM and aftermarket segments. The OEM market is focusing on new energy vehicles, while the aftermarket is driven by demand for film replacement and customization [6][7]. Competitive Landscape - The automotive film market in China features numerous participants, including international brands like 3M and domestic companies such as Wan Shun New Materials and Naer Co., Ltd. International brands dominate the high-end market, while domestic companies are rapidly improving their product offerings and gaining market share in the mid-range segment [10][11]. Company Analysis - Wan Shun New Materials focuses on new materials and reported a revenue of 2.692 billion yuan in the first half of 2025, with functional film business contributing 0.12 million yuan [11]. Naer Co., Ltd. specializes in precision coating and reported a revenue of 972 million yuan in the first half of 2025, with automotive functional films accounting for 29.55% of total revenue [11][12]. Development Trends - The automotive film industry is transitioning towards high-tech integration, with advancements in materials and processes driving the evolution of products. Innovations such as nano-ceramics and smart films are enhancing functionality, while a shift towards a service-oriented model is emerging, focusing on customer experience throughout the product lifecycle [12].
